Biman Gaon Population - Tehri Garhwal, Uttarakhand

Biman Gaon is a small village located in Narendranagar Tehsil of Tehri Garhwal district, Uttarakhand with total 24 families residing. The Biman Gaon village has population of 88 of which 41 are males while 47 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Biman Gaon village population of children with age 0-6 is 8 which makes up 9.09 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Biman Gaon village is 1146 which is higher than Uttarakhand state average of 963. Child Sex Ratio for the Biman Gaon as per census is 1667, higher than Uttarakhand average of 890.

Biman Gaon village has lower literacy rate compared to Uttarakhand. In 2011, literacy rate of Biman Gaon village was 73.75 % compared to 78.82 % of Uttarakhand. In Biman Gaon Male literacy stands at 86.84 % while female literacy rate was 61.90 %.
